Alright, come in, come in and make yourself at home. Make yourself at home. In English it means you can feel relaxed as if you were at your own place, at your own place. So make yourself at home and let me show you around. Let me show you around. So let me show you the place. Come in.
So this is the hallway. This is the hallway, the first part of the flat. And as you can see on the left there is a fitted wardrobe. It is fitted, so it is built in, built in the space that is available here, fitted wardrobe.
Alright, so let's go left first. Let's go left and this is the kitchen area. As you can see it is combined, it is combined so it is together with the living room space. So the kitchen area and it's quite small with plenty of kitchen cabinets, kitchen cabinets and kitchen drawers, drawers, for cups, plates, pans and pots and in general kitchenware, kitchenware, kitchen stuff.
There is a sink over here on the left and here on the right the oven. And the cooktop with the hob where you can cook your meals. Also there are some kitchen appliances, so kitchen equipment, appliances, like obviously the fridge, the most important piece of furniture in your flat, the freezer where you can freeze products, there is a dishwasher here and also some smaller appliances and stuff like that.
Oh and obviously there is a small table which is a kitchen island, kitchen island in the middle, with two bar stools, bar stools to special chairs for having your daily meals. It's not that big, but it's quite convenient because it has plenty of drawers so a lot of storage space.
And now let's move on to the living room area over here. Here is a nice coffee table in the middle. Here on the left there is a nice small sofa, two seater, two seater, so far for two people, and one comfortable armchair, love this armchair, here in front, and on the right a small footstool, a footstool, so a place where you can put your feet up when you're sitting, a footstool, or ottoman, yeah.
And as you can see it's a set, it's a set so they match, they match, which means they are similar and they go well together, they match. And opposite the sofa there is a nice big balcony door which overlooks the garden and the neighbourhood.
Yeah, and now opposite the kitchen there is another room, a study, so a place for work, or study. It's a nice place separated by a glass door, there is a small desk here on the left which is also a cabinet, and here opposite the desk there is a small sofa. But the main part of the room is here opposite in the middle, which is this giant bookcase that takes up all the wall here opposite. So plenty of space for books and work stuff.
Alright, and the last room, which is bedroom, is situated on the opposite end of the flat. It's all very light and simple. There is a big bed in the middle and two bedside tables on the sides, bedside tables, quite simple and cosy, cosy.
Here again there is a balcony door and a second balcony. It's smaller than the first one which offers plenty of shade on summer days.
Alright, that's pretty much it. Oh, there is also a bathroom, there is also a bathroom here across the hallway, with a big mirror and the wash basin in the centre part that lights up, lights up. So there is light around the mirror, which is cool. And here on the right shower and on the left the toilet obviously and also a washing machine and some cabinets for cosmetics and towels.
